Ally Boothroyd
RG Wake Team- Ontario
Ally coached at RadGalz Wake and YOGA Clinix in Ontario in summer 2008 alongside Erika Langman. She launched a website (alongside Erika Langman) to promote her multiple skill set both on a board and behind a camera, but also to put the attention on the female wakeboard scene throughout the world, which is pretty sick...Check out her site throwitdown.ca !

Current Board Set-up: LF Jet 136 (signed by Amber!) and Wing limited edition closed toe boots , stance all the way out and ducked.

Competitive Results: Results are not something that is generally on my mind… ever, but I’ve had some decent results since I got into the competitive circuit,
1st place Kawartha Lakes Wakeboard Open 2008, 3rd place X Cup, 4th place Ontario Provincials, 4th place Rock the Wake, 6th place Nationals…
